A powder surface coating machine applies a protective or functional powder layer onto materials. This machine boosts durability, corrosion resistance, and appearance.
A powder coating machine uses electrostatic forces to spray powder onto a surface, then heat cures it to form a strong and smooth finish.
This article explains how the machine works, the types available, the key components, and why it's valuable for manufacturers.
The Working Principle of a Powder Surface Coating Machine?
The coating process combines electrostatic spraying with heat curing. It works through the following steps:
Electrostatic powder coating involves spraying charged particles onto grounded surfaces, followed by baking to form a solid coating.
Step-by-Step Process:
- Powder Application – Powder is sprayed onto a surface using an electrostatic spray gun.
- Electrostatic Adhesion – Powder particles receive a charge and stick to the object.
- Curing Process – The coated material is heated in an oven to melt and bond the powder.
- Cooling & Inspection – The object cools and is inspected for coating quality.
This system creates uniform, durable finishes with minimal waste.
Types of Powder Surface Coating Machines?
Powder coating machines come in several types, each suited for specific applications.
Choose between manual or automated machines depending on your production scale and coating needs.
Common Types:
Type | Description |
---|---|
Manual Powder Coating Machine | Used for small batches or custom jobs, operated by hand. |
Automatic Powder Coating Machine | Ideal for high-volume production with automated lines. |
Fluidized Bed Coating Machine | Dips heated parts into a powder bed for thick coatings. |
Electrostatic Coating System | Charges powder particles for efficient, even coating. |
Each machine type has strengths in terms of precision, thickness, and volume.
Key Components of a Powder Surface Coating Machine?
Every powder coating machine includes key parts that work together for optimal results.
A typical powder coating machine includes a spray gun, booth, curing oven, and recovery system.
Component Breakdown:
Component | Function |
---|---|
Powder Spray Gun | Applies electrostatically charged powder. |
Powder Supply Unit | Stores and feeds powder to the gun. |
Coating Booth | Captures overspray and contains powder. |
Curing Oven | Heats parts to cure the powder. |
Powder Recovery System | Collects excess powder for reuse. |
These components ensure consistent, clean, and efficient powder application.
Advantages of Using a Powder Surface Coating Machine?
Switching to powder coating has many upsides compared to liquid painting.
Powder coating machines create strong, eco-friendly finishes with low waste and fast turnaround.
Key Benefits:
- ✔ Durability – Resistant to chips, scratches, and corrosion.
- ✔ Eco-Friendly – Low VOCs and recyclable powder.
- ✔ Cost Savings – Efficient material use and minimal waste.
- ✔ Even Coating – Consistent thickness across surfaces.
- ✔ Fast Processing – Quick to apply and cure.
These benefits make powder coating a smart choice for many industries.
Applications of Powder Surface Coating Machines?
Powder coating is used wherever durability and visual appeal are essential.
From automotive to construction, powder coating is a trusted solution for industrial protection.
Common Uses:
Industry | Application Examples |
---|---|
Automotive | Wheels, chassis, engine parts |
Furniture | Metal shelves, frames, office chairs |
Construction | Window frames, fencing, steel beams |
Industrial Equipment | Tools, machine parts, piping |
These examples show the wide scope of powder coating in real-world products.
